Market Freezers Ambience
2016
22 min. sound loop


A 22 min. sound loop composed of sounds recorded from the different freezers in a supermarket in Husavik, Iceland. The sounds are played in a speaker inside a white plastic grocery bag.




Untitled (natural Sets)
2016
Video Installation
Frozen lake video loop :  12 min. 14 sec.
Sci-Fi clips video loop : 6min.
A video installation with a projected landscape of a frozen lake on top of a TV screen playing a video compilation of Sci-Fi movie clips filmed in Iceland.

Fresh Window is pleased to present Invented Landscape, a solo exhibition of new works by Magdalen Wong. The work in this installation was developed during her residency in Iceland in the spring of 2016. The large projection video is a quiet video of a frozen lake in Húsavík, the town where the residency was. The video playing on the TV is comprised of edited clips from science fiction movies filmed in Iceland. This installation overlaps the silence and tranquility of Iceland with the fictional landscapes used as sets for sci-fi/fantasy movies. Time collapses in these altered landscapes, as the present-day nature becomes a futuristic scenery or a fantasyland. The subtle yet strong sound of this installation helps provide the post-apocalyptic atmosphere of this frozen volcanic landscape, which was created by different recordings of refrigerators and freezers. And though the sounds are generated from machines, it references the natural sounds that reflect not only the frozen lake, but also the fantasy landscape. 


Magdalen Wong, (b. 1981 Hong Kong) received her BFA at Maryland Institute College of Art in 2003, and her MFA with a Trustee Merit Scholarship at the School of the Art Institute of Chicago in 2005. Wong had received grants and attended residencies in Vermont Studio Center, Goyang Art Studio in Seoul, Skowhegan School of Painting and Sculpture, Yaddo, and Fjuk Art Center in Iceland. Currently she is invited as a resident artist at Institut Supérieur des Beaux Arts de Besançon in France. She had exhibited at Witte de With, Center for Cotemporary Art, The Netherlands; Para/site Art Space, Hong Kong; Spring, Hong Kong; Urban Institute of Contemporary Art, Grand Rapids; Gallery 400, Chicago; Outlet Gallery, Brooklyn; Laurence Miller Gallery, NY; NurtureArt, Brooklyn; and Fresh Window Gallery, Brooklyn.
